What is Category B?

Category B, often referred to as the "cars and truck and little van" classification, is a type of driving license that allows the holder to drive lorries as much as 3,500 kgs (kg) in weight, including little vans and pickup trucks. This category is especially crucial for individuals who require to drive for personal or professional reasons, as it covers most of vehicles utilized in everyday life.

The Application Process

  1. Eligibility Requirements

    • Age: Applicants should be at least 17 years of ages to look for a provisional license and 17 years and 6 months old to take the dry run.
    • Residency: Applicants need to be homeowners of the nation where they are obtaining the license.
    • Health: Applicants must meet the minimum health and vision standards set by the licensing authority.
  2. Provisionary License

    • Before taking the practical test, candidates need to first acquire a provisionary driving license. This can be done online, by post, or prawa jazdy na Sprzedaż face to face at a designated office.
    • The provisionary license enables the candidate to practice driving with a certified trainer or a certified chauffeur who is at least 21 years old and has held a complete driving license for a minimum of three years.
  3. Theory Test

    • The theory test is an essential step in the process. It includes 2 parts: a multiple-choice section and a risk understanding test.
    • Multiple-Choice Section: This part checks the candidate's understanding of the Highway Code, roadway signs, and safe driving practices. The test includes 50 questions, and applicants need to score at least 43 out of 50 to pass.
    • Threat Perception Test: This section assesses the applicant's capability to recognize and react to potential risks on the road. The test includes 14 video clips, and applicants should score a minimum of 44 out of 75 to pass.
  4. Dry run

    • As soon as the theory test is passed, the applicant can reserve a useful driving test. The dry run is designed to assess the candidate's capability to drive safely and competently on numerous kinds of roads.
    • Driving Skills: The test includes a series of maneuvers such as reversing around a corner, parallel parking, and an emergency stop.
    • Independent Driving: The candidate will also be required to drive individually, following instructions from a sat nav or traffic indications.
    • General Driving: The examiner will examine the candidate's total driving abilities, including their ability to follow the guidelines of the road, manage speed, and handle the automobile securely.

FAQs

Q: What is the minimum age to get a Category B driving license?

  • A: The minimum age to obtain a provisional license is 17 years of ages, and the minimum age to take the useful test is 17 years and 6 months old.

Q: Can I drive a bike with a Category B license?

  • A: No, a Category B license does not cover motorcycles. You would require a different motorbike license (Category A) to drive a motorbike.

Q: How long does the theory test take?

  • A: The theory test generally takes about 57 minutes in overall. The multiple-choice area takes 57 minutes, and the hazard perception test takes about 20 minutes.

Q: What happens if I fail the dry run?

  • A: If you fail the dry run, you can retake it after a certain period, which differs by nation. It's a great idea to take extra lessons to deal with any locations where you had a hard time before retaking the test.

Q: Can I drive a small van with a Category B license?

  • A: Yes, a Category B license permits you to drive small vans and pickup up to 3,500 kg in weight.
